Warzone is demanding, and its settings menu is one of the most detailed in any live-service game. Most defaults are not tuned for competitive play. Here is what to change.
Display
Display Mode — Fullscreen Exclusive for lowest latency. If you encounter crashes, use Borderless.
Render Resolution — 100. Below 100 uses DLSS/FSR upscaling which softens the image. Stay at native unless your GPU genuinely cannot handle it.
Refresh Rate — Maximum supported by your monitor.
V-Sync — Off. Use adaptive sync (G-Sync/FreeSync) through your GPU driver instead.
NVIDIA Reflex — On + Boost if you have an Nvidia GPU. Significant latency reduction with essentially no performance cost.
Quality Presets
Start from the Balanced preset, then override the following:
| Setting | Value |
|---|---|
| Shadow Map Resolution | Low |
| Screen Space Shadows | Off |
| Spot Shadow Quality | Low |
| Particle Lighting | Low |
| Ambient Occlusion | Off |
| Screen Space Reflections | Off |
| Anti-Aliasing | SMAA T2X or Off |
| Texture Resolution | High (VRAM permitting) |
| Texture Filter Anisotropic | Normal |
| Depth of Field | Off |
| World Motion Blur | Off |
| Weapon Motion Blur | Off |
| Film Grain | 0.00 |
Field of View
FOV — 100–110 for most players. Higher FOV lets you see more of the environment. Above 110 causes distortion at the edges that can be disorienting.
ADS FOV — Affected, not Independent. Independent mode zooms in less when aiming, which some find disorienting.
Monitor OSD Settings
Warzone's color palette skews warm and yellow in many map areas. On your monitor:
- Color Temperature — Neutral or slightly cool (6500K–7000K)
- Brightness — 60–70% of max. The game can look washed out at high brightness
- Black Level — If your monitor has this, bring it down slightly to improve shadow detail
- Response Time — Fastest setting without overshoot artifacts
Enable adaptive sync in your monitor OSD and GPU driver for smooth frame delivery.
